Question Adding liverock

I have liverock in another tank that has been running for a couple years. If I move it to another tank will I still have to cure it?? Also...as I posted earlier...there is a lot of green algae on the rock so they will most likely be sitting in the dark for a little while.

If the rock has been in an established tank for that long, it is already cured and safe to add to another system.
